What are graduates?

Graduates are individuals who have successfully completed a degree program at a college or university, typically earning a bachelor's, master's, or doctoral degree. They are often entering the workforce for the first time in their field of study or pursuing further education. Graduates may seek entry-level positions, internships, or graduate schemes to begin their professional careers and gain practical experience. Their skills and qualifications can vary depending on their course of study and level of education.

What is the difference between Graduate vs Intern?

AspectGraduateIntern
CredentialsDegree or diploma, often recent graduateUsually students or recent graduates, may not have completed degree
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, full-time position with responsibilitiesTemporary, part-time or short-term experience
Employer UsageHired as a permanent or semi-permanent employeeLearning experience, often unpaid or stipend-based
Search & Comparison IntentLooking for entry-level roles after graduationSeeking practical experience or career exploration

In summary, a Graduate typically refers to someone who has completed their education and is seeking a full-time entry-level position, while an Intern is usually a student or recent graduate gaining practical experience through a temporary role. Both roles are important for career development but differ mainly in duration, responsibilities, and employment status.

Scope of Job
JOB DESCRIPTION
We are seeking a highly motivated and enthusiastic Graduate Assistant to join our team and assist with our graduate recruitment efforts. As a Graduate Assistant, you will play a crucial role in attracting and advising prospective students about our graduate programs. Your primary responsibility will be to provide excellent customer service by answering inquiries and guiding prospective students through the admission process, requirements, and career outlook with a graduate degree. You will interact with prospective students via phone, email, text message, live chat, and video.
DUTIES
  • Provide exceptional customer service to prospective graduate students by promptly responding to inquiries via phone, email, text message, live chat, and video.
  • Assist prospective students with questions regarding the admission process, requirements, deadlines, program details, and career opportunities associated with our graduate programs.
  • Maintain a thorough knowledge and understanding of all graduate programs offered, including program prerequisites, curriculum, faculty, and any program-specific requirements.
  • Effectively communicate the benefits and advantages of pursuing a graduate degree at UTRGV, highlighting unique features and opportunities.
  • Coordinate and schedule appointments and information sessions for prospective students, ensuring a seamless and positive experience.
  • Collaborate with the Graduate Recruitment team to organize and participate in recruitment events, such as graduate fairs, information sessions, and webinars.
  • Assist in the development and enhancement of recruitment materials, including brochures, presentations, and website content.
  • Maintain accurate records of prospective student interactions and inquiries using the appropriate customer relationship management (CRM) tools.
  • Assist with other graduate recruitment duties as assigned, which may include data entry, administrative tasks, or support during recruitment campaigns.
